Participants on this PDST TiE course will explore a range of digital tools that they can easily integrate into their classroom. Simple changes in the teaching, learning and assessment tools can increase active learning, cut down on the time spent searching for resources and sources of information and facilitate engaging forms of assessment!
Teachers will interact and experiment with an array of tools, websites and technologies throughout the course. They will use these tools in activities that can be adapted and replicated in their own classrooms.
Questions and issues explored in the course include:
● Where can my pupils access safe trustworthy information online?
● What resources are out there specifically for Irish classrooms?
● How can I make assessment an engaging component of my lessons?
● Where can I find resources to deal with online safety and cyberbullying?
● How can my school plan together to embed Digital Technologies in teaching, learning and assessment using the Digital Learning Framework?
